GitHub Gists

GitHub Gists are a feature of GitHub that allows users to easily share snippets of code or text. Think of a Gist as a mini-repository where you can store and collaborate on small pieces of information, such as code examples, notes, or configuration files. Each Gist can be public, for anyone to see, or secret, only shared with selected people. They are useful for sharing code quickly without needing a full project, and they support version control, meaning you can track changes over time. Gists make it easier to collaborate and share knowledge within the programming community.
